Undergraduate Student Hanbi Liu Wins AIChE Separations Poster Competition

Hanbi Liu, senior undergraduate student, recently won first place in the Division 1 Separations Poster Competition at the annual American Institute of Chemical Engineer’s meeting in Atlanta, Georgia.

Sophomore Allison Wagman Wins Undergraduate Research Poster Competition

Sophomore Allison Wagman recently won first place in the Undergraduate Research Competition hosted by the Cockrell School’s Student Engineering Council.

Allison’s poster, “Yeast Promoter Mutations Modeled by Nucleosome Affinity”, showcased her research conducted alongside Professor Hal Alper to create novel synthetic parts for cells.
